Associations to the word «Utica»

Wiktionary

UTICA, proper noun. A Phoenician colony on the African coast, near Carthage.
UTICA, proper noun. Any of various cities in the United States.

Dictionary definition

UTICA, noun. A city in central New York.
UTICA, noun. An ancient city on the north coast of Africa (northwest of Carthage); destroyed by Arabs around 700 AD.
